Taylor Swift Brings Out Fifth Harmony for ‘Worth It’ in California

Taylor Swift and Fifth Harmony

Ascendant girl group Fifth Harmony have twice covered Taylor Swift in their career, performing “We Are Never Ever Getting Back Together” during their initial run on the X Factor USA, and then taking on “Red” a capella for Idolator a couple years back. Last night at Levi’s Stadium in Santa Clara, CA, Taylor returned the favor. Introducing Fifth Harmony as “one of the biggest and most successful groups in the world… [with] one of the most powerful and loyal fanbases in the entire world,” she brought the quintet out for a rendition of their smash hit “Worth It,” dressing and dancing like the group’s sixth member.
